Frequently Asked Questions about Knifley
What type of rentals are currently available in Knifley?
There are currently 49 Apartments for Rent in Knifley, KY with pricing that ranges from $600 to $2,299. There are also 41 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Knifley ranging from $399 to $3,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Knifley?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Knifley ranges from $399 to $3,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,134.
